- The distance between Essej, Russia and La Paz, Baja California, Mexico is approximately 9,378 km or 5,828 mi.
- To reach Essej in this distance one would set out from La Paz, Baja California bearing 348.5° or NNW and follow the great circles arc to approach Essej bearing 209.6° or SSW .
- Essej has a boreal subarctic climate with no dry season (Dfc) whereas La Paz, Baja California has a subtropical hot desert climate (BWh).
- Essej is in or near the subpolar moist tundra biome whereas La Paz, Baja California is in or near the subtropical desert scrub biome.
- The annual mean temperature is 36.2 °C (65.2°F) cooler.
- Average monthly temperatures vary by 37.7 °C (67.9°F) more in Essej. The continentality subtype is hypercontinental as opposed to truly oceanic.
- Total annual precipitation averages 33.6 mm (1.3 in) more which is equivalent to 33.6 l/m² (0.82 US gal/ft²) or 336,000 l/ha (35,921 US gal/ac) more. About 1 1/6 as much.
- The altitude of the sun at midday is overall 44.2° lower in Essej than in La Paz, Baja California.
